Description

Gojirox-CV Tablet is a fixed-dose combination antibiotic formulation designed to provide broad-spectrum antibacterial action against a wide range of bacterial infections, including those caused by β-lactamase–producing organisms. Cefuroxime, a second-generation cephalosporin antibiotic, works by inhibiting bacterial cell wall synthesis, ultimately leading to bacterial death. It is effective against many Gram-positive and Gram-negative pathogens. However, some bacteria produce β-lactamase enzymes that can deactivate cefuroxime. To overcome this resistance, Clavulanic Acid, a potent β-lactamase inhibitor, is combined with cefuroxime. Clavulanic acid has minimal direct antibacterial activity but prevents the enzymatic degradation of cefuroxime, thereby restoring and enhancing its effectiveness. This combination is commonly used in the treatment of respiratory tract infections (such as sinusitis, pharyngitis, tonsillitis, bronchitis, and community-acquired pneumonia), skin and soft-tissue infections, urinary tract infections, and certain ENT infections. It is also beneficial in mixed infections where multiple organisms might be involved or where resistance to standard antibiotics is suspected. The recommended dosage and duration depend on the severity of the infection, patient age, renal function, and clinical judgment. Tablets should typically be taken after meals to enhance absorption and reduce gastrointestinal discomfort. Common side effects may include nausea, diarrhea, abdominal pain, headache, and rash. As with all antibiotics, inappropriate or incomplete use may contribute to antimicrobial resistance. The combination should be used with caution in patients with a history of hypersensitivity to β-lactam antibiotics and in those with impaired kidney or liver function. Overall, Cefuroxime 500 mg + Clavulanic Acid 125 mg Tablet offers a synergistic and reliable therapeutic option for managing a wide variety of bacterial infections, especially when resistance is a concern. Always use under medical supervision.
